Top Highlights
Brand Lenovo
Model name IdeaPad 5 Chrome 14ITL6
Screen size 14 Inches
Colour Storm Grey
Hard disk size 512 GB
CPU model Core i5
The light 1,42 kg and slim 16,6 mm body is made to be carried around
Stream content at Full-HD with the IdeaPad 5 Chromebook’s 14" IPS display, featuring narrow three-sized bezels so you get more screen
WiFi 6 and Bluetooth connectivity as well as 10-hour battery life mean you can wander about all day while staying connected and productive
Take care of your privacy with camera privacy shutter, mute mic key and Google Security Chip H1
Connections for all your needs: USB 3.2 Gen 1, 2x USB-C 3.2 Gen 1 (support data transfer, Power Delivery 3.0 and DisplayPort 1.4), microSD card reader, audio jack (3.5mm)
